Backend.AI Accelerator Plugin for CUDA (Mockup)
Project description
backend.ai-accelerator-cuda-mock
A mockup plugin for CUDA accelerators
This plugin deceives the agent and manager to think as if there are CUDA devices.
The configuration follows cuda-mock.toml
placed in the same location of agent.toml
.
Please refer the sample configurations in the configs/accelerator
directory and copy one of them as a starting point.
The statistics are randomly generated in reasonable ranges, but it may seem like "jumping around" because there is no smoothing mechanism of generated values. The configurations for fractional/discrete mode, fraction size, and device masks in etcd are exactly same as the original plugin.
The containers are created without any real CUDA device mounts but with BACKENDAI_MOCK_CUDA_DEVICES
and BACKENDAI_MOCK_CUDA_DEVICE_COUNT
environment variables.
Since the manager does not know if the reported devices are real or not, you can start any CUDA-only containers (but of course they won't work as expected).
